At a glance
CVE-2026-0722 is a medium-severity Improper Neutralization of Special Elements used in an SQL Command ('SQL Injection') vulnerability in the Shield Security WordPress plugin, affecting versions <= 21.0.8. It carries a CVSS score of 6.5 (reachable over the network; low attack complexity; high confidentiality impact). Exploitation requires no authentication. The issue is fixed in version 21.0.10; sites on affected versions should update now. Disclosed February 2026, reported by Dmitrii Ignatyev.
Vulnerability Overview
The Shield Security plugin for WordPress is vulnerable to Cross-Site Request Forgery in all versions up to, and including, 21.0.8. This is due to the plugin allowing nonce verification to be bypassed via user-supplied parameter in the 'isNonceVerifyRequired' function. This makes it possible for unauthenticated attackers to execute SQL injection attacks, extracting sensitive information from the database, via a forged request granted they can trick a site administrator into performing an action such as clicking on a link.
Technical Analysis
The vector marks this flaw as remotely reachable over the network, with low attack complexity — no special timing or configuration is needed, and no privileges on the target site. A successful exploit has high impact on confidentiality.
CWE-89: Improper Neutralization of Special Elements used in an SQL Command ('SQL Injection')
Shield Security <= 21.0.8 carries this weakness at isNonceVerifyRequired, and reaching it takes a caller who can reach the endpoint. SQL injection happens when request data is concatenated into a query instead of being bound as a parameter, letting an attacker change the structure of the statement rather than just its values.
A working injection can read any table the database user can see, which on a WordPress install means user records, password hashes and session or API secrets stored in options. For Shield Security the fix is 21.0.10: builds <= 21.0.8 are affected, anything from 21.0.10 onward is not.
Remediation
Update to version 21.0.10, or a newer patched version
